1.0 MODULE OVERVIEW


Effective communication is a crucial skill for personal and professional success. This module will explore
the key principles and techniques of communication to help you enhance your ability to express ideas,
listen actively, and engage with others

This course also provides an introduction to the fundamental concepts and principles of communication,
information, and computer technology. Students will explore the historical development, current trends,
and future implications of these interrelated fields. The course covers topics such as information theory,
communication systems, digital technologies, and the role of computers in modern society.

3.0 Course Objectives


By the end of this course, students will be able to: By the end of this module, participants will be able to:

Understand the Importance of Effective Communication

Recognize the impact of communication on personal and professional success

Appreciate the role of communication in building relationships and achieving goals

Develop Active Listening Skills

Practice techniques for active and engaged listening

Demonstrate the ability to paraphrase, ask relevant questions, and provide feedback to ensure mutual
understanding

Communicate with Clarity and Concision

Organize thoughts and ideas in a clear and logical manner

Use simple, straightforward language to convey messages effectively

Avoid jargon and technical terms when unnecessary

Recognize and Manage Nonverbal Communication

Analyze the impact of body language, tone of voice, and facial expressions on the overall message

Adjust nonverbal cues to align with the intended communication

Cultivate Empathy and Emotional Intelligence

Demonstrate the ability to understand and respond to the emotions and perspectives of others

Adapt communication style based on the audience and situation

Seek and Provide Constructive Feedback

Actively seek feedback on communication skills from peers and supervisors

Reflect on areas for improvement and develop a plan for continuous learning

Explain the basic concepts and principles of communication, information, and computer technology.
Analyze the evolution and convergence of these fields and their impact on society.

Demonstrate understanding of the various components and technologies that comprise communication
and information systems.

Evaluate the ethical and social implications of the widespread use of digital technologies.

Apply critical thinking and problem-solving skills to address challenges and opportunities in the field.
